PoliciesResources & EnvironmentVideos Vietnam takes steps towards net zero emissions The issuance of the national plan on the implementation of the Glasgow Leaders’ Declaration on Forests and Land Use is another step taken by the Vietnamese Government towards achieving net zero emissions by 2050.
